Facilities Maintenance Technician
Bandit Lites, Inc.
Job Summary
The Facilities Maintenance Technician is responsible for the day-to-day upkeep, cleanliness, and organization of the Bandit Lites facilities, including the warehouse and office areas. This role encompasses a variety of tasks to ensure a clean, safe, and efficient working environment, supporting the smooth operation of the company’s physical infrastructure.
Job Responsibilities And Requirements
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Other duties may be assigned.
- Understands, abides by, and instills the philosophy, policies, and procedures of Bandit Lites.
- Maintain cleanliness and organization in both the warehouse and office areas, ensuring that common spaces, meeting rooms, and work areas are tidy and hygienic.
- Perform routine cleaning tasks, including vacuuming, sanitizing surfaces, and restocking supplies.
- Ensure trash bins are emptied regularly and manage waste disposal in a responsible manner. This will include dump runs with our trucks as well as recycling electronic waste.
- Deep clean and sanitize areas as needed, including kitchens, breakrooms, and high-touch surfaces.
- Perform minor repairs on facilities equipment, furniture, and fixtures, including replacing light bulbs, air filters, and repairing doors, locks, drywall, and plumbing issues.
- Repair and paint walls as needed to keep things looking clean.
- Coordinate with and oversee outside vendors for larger building repairs as needed.
- Perform repair and maintenance of he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ems by conducting routine checks.
- Assist with organizing, setting up, and breaking down catering events, meetings, and other company functions as needed.
- Maintain the exterior of the facility, including parking lots, sidewalks, landscaping, green spaces, and outdoor areas.
- Ensure proper functioning of facility lighting and basic upkeep of building surroundings.
- Manage inventory and ensure adequate stock of cleaning supplies, toiletries.
- Regularly check and maintain stock levels of janitorial and maintenance supplies, placing orders as necessary.
- Follow safety protocols and regulations, including the safe use of cleaning chemicals, equipment, and tools.
- Assist with miscellaneous tasks related to the overall maintenance of the Bandit Lites’ Knoxville facility.
- Support other bandit facilities teams as needed. Occasional trips to other offices might be required from time to time.
- Assist with small package shipping in Knoxville as needed.
- Support bandit safety initiatives with direction from Safety Director
- Schedule service and generally maintain reach truck, company box trucks and other vehicles.
Requirements And Expectations
- Strong knowledge of general maintenance and repair tasks across a variety of systems.
- Ability to operate cleaning equipment and tools safely and effectively.
- Familiarity with equipment safety protocols and procedures.
- Basic knowledge of facilities management, including plumbing, electrical, and HVAC systems.
- Ability to lift up to 50lbs and to stand/walk for extended periods.
Preferred Skills
Strong attention to detail and problem-solving skills, possess strong work ethic; both reliable and punctual, the ability to work independently and prioritize tasks effectively,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, Flexibility to adjust to changing priorities and emergencies, excellent time management skills and the ability to multi-task, physical stamina and ability to perform role requirements.
Qualifications
Education: High school diploma, additional technical certifications are a plus.
Experience: 2+ years of experience in facilities management or maintenance is preferred
